Unlike the entertainment industry, which snatches (marginally) talented kids off the streets, cokes ‘em up and feeds them to the sharks, the NBA has a rule that not only forces a kid to be talented, but it takes it a step further and won’t allow a player to be drafted until they are 1 year out of high school and at least 19 years old. Ostensibly, this rule is to make sure that drafted players are mature enough to handle the demands of an NBA career (i.e. millions of dollars, fame and pussy galore). I respect this rule and the reasoning behind it, but I can’t help wondering how much of a difference handing millions of dollars to a 19 year old instead of to an 18 year old really is.
To their credit, the NBA is also marginally better than the entertainment industry at mentoring these kids on how to deal with their new lives, (example: Shaq maybe advising Kobe to pay off the hos he sleeps with to stay quiet and not cry rape), but we are still talking about some pretty sheltered young people. To have made it this far, these kids have been training for years, basketball has been their whole lives. For the most part, none of these kids have so much as held a part time job because their focus has been so basketball-centric; a focus that will be rewarded handsomely tonight. Since they began to show potential (or just grew A LOT during puberty), they have been groomed for this moment- entry into the NBA and a career of playing ball all day everyday – and not a whole lot more.
